Yoshimura tabs game-high 19 points, but Women's Basketball falls 60-50 to Austin College

SHERMAN, Texas - The University of Dallas women's basketball team (6-9, 1-6 SCAC) fell 60-50 to Austin College on Friday evening at Hughey Gym, as the Lady Crusaders converted just 27.6-percent from the field. 

Austin (8-10, 2-6 SCAC) held a 31-19 halftime advantage, after the Lady 'Roos made 11-of-23 (47.8 percent) from the floor in the first half.

Senior guard Kylie Yoshimura (Temple City, Calif.) tallied 15 of her game-high 19 points in the second-half to help Dallas outscore Austin 31-29 in the period. 

Brooke Hagemann (Oklahoma City, Okla.) also scored in double figures, as the sophomore guard ended with 16 points. 

Head coach Jina Johansen's squad netted 14-of-18 from the free-throw line in the second half, but Brittany Stepanski's double-double (18 points, 10 rebounds) helped the Lady 'Roos to a 10-point triumph. 

Austin achieved a 24-2 bench-points advantage and outrebounded Dallas 43-31 for the game. 

The Lady Crusaders forced their counterpart into 22 turnovers and finished with a 19-5 points-off-turnovers margin.
